Apple's GarageBand 09 update fixes 'Learn to Play'

updated 12:35 am EST, Thu February 5, 2009

GarageBand update


Apple has released an latest update to the recently released GarageBand '09, its music creation and recording application for the Mac. GarageBand '09 was announced at Macworld Expo in January as part of the iLife '09 suite and began shipping in late January; the software works as a recording studio to help users create music, play an instrument, or record a song. The software features tools for learning how to play songs with a guitar or piano, shown by the artists who made them. In the newest version of GarageBand, improvements were made to the overall stability of the program, along with addressing specific issues regarding downloading lessons from the Learn to Play Lession Store.

The update is recommended for all GarageBand ‘09 users and requires Mac OS X 10.5.6 or later. Users can download the update from the apple support page, and is sized at 26.7MB.
